What Are Dentures and Partials?
Dentures and partials are removable dental prosthetic devices designed to replace missing teeth and their surrounding tissues. They provide a reliable solution to restore your smile if you are not eligible for dental implants. At Covenant Dental, we offer complete dentures for those requiring full-arch restoration and partial dentures for patients with some healthy teeth remaining.
The following is a look at your complete denture options:
- Immediate Dentures: Immediate dentures are positioned immediately after removing any remaining failing teeth, so you don't go without teeth for a single day. However, as your gums and jawbone heal, they shrink and change shape, meaning your dentures may no longer provide a comfortable fit. Immediate dentures are considered interim restorations worn for about 3-4 months during healing.
- Conventional Dentures: Conventional dentures are created from impressions of your mouth after the area heals, providing the best possible fit, comfort, and function. Your new restorations will allow you to enjoy a wider variety of your favorite foods, speak more clearly, and smile with confidence. With proper care, they have the potential to last for many years.
The following are your partial denture options:
- Metal Frame Partials: These traditional partials provide a strong, durable solution to complete your smile. They consist of metal frameworks covered by a gum-colored material supporting prosthetic teeth made to match your smile. They are secured to your natural teeth using metal clasps or more aesthetic precision attachments.
- Flexible Partials: Flexible partials are removable oral appliances made from a flexible, biocompatible material. They are designed to be more comfortable and less noticeable than other denture options. Flexible partials don't require metal clasps, using thin extensions to grip onto your gums.
What Are Implant-Supported Dentures?
Implant-supported dentures provide a secure and comfortable alternative to traditional dentures. These removable overdentures are secured to a few dental implants placed strategically in your jawbone, significantly improving function. If you already have traditional dentures, we are happy to convert them into overdentures to provide better retention, stability, and chewing ability. Implant dentistry is the gold standard for replacing missing teeth, leaving you with exceptional outcomes.
What Are the Benefits of Dentures and Partials?
The following is a look at some of the benefits of complete and partial dentures:
- Natural Looking: Today's modern denture options are sleeker, more functional, and more aesthetic than those of the past, enhancing your smile and quality of life.
- Enhanced Function: You'll be able to chew your food more effectively and speak more clearly.
- Preserving Facial Structure: Complete dentures help support your facial structure, preventing a sunken appearance and maintaining your natural contours.
- Maintaining Alignment: Partial dentures help prevent any remaining teeth from shifting toward the gap, preserving the integrity of your bite.
- Cost-Effective: Complete and partial dentures offer a cost-effective solution to restore your smile.
